Corsican Hare vs Kaapori Capuchin
Lepus corsicanus compared with Cebus kaapori
Key Differences
- Corsican Hare is Vulnerable while Kaapori Capuchin is Critically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Corsican Hare | Kaapori Capuchin |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(hayvan) | Animalia (hayvan)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Kordalılar) | Chordata (Kordalılar) |
| Class same | Mammalia (memeliler) | Mammalia (memeliler) |
| Order | Lagomorpha (Tavşanımsılar) | Primates (Primat) |
| Family | Leporidae (Rabbits & Hares) | Cebidae |
| Genus | Lepus | Cebus |
| Species | Lepus corsicanus | Cebus kaapori |
Evolutionary Relationship
Corsican Hare and Kaapori Capuchin share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(memeliler)
